Comic Character Collectibles by J.C. Vaughn Heritage Auctions’ November 15-17, 2018 Comics & Comic Art Auction made headlines when it closed at $10,776,936 in total sales and the company reported a 99.36% sell-through rate. The Belgium-based Boon Foundation for Narrative Graphic Arts garnered the biggest headlines of the event with their $600,000 bid for Bernie […]

Comic Character Collectibles By J.C. Vaughn Heritage Auctions has continued to find fertile ground in the world of pop culture, as witnessed by their July 28-29, 2018 Movie Poster Auction and their August 2-4 Comics & Comic Art Auction. The company’s Movie Poster Auction totaled over $1.6 million when all was said and done, and […]

Results of Recent Auctions From Near and Far by Ken Hall Original artwork by legendary artist Frank Frazetta titled Death Dealer 6 (1990), first published as the cover for Verotik’s 1996 Death Dealer #2 comic book, sold for $1.79 million at a World Record Comic Book & Art Auction held May 10-12 by Heritage Auctions […]

Comic Character Collectibles By J.C. Vaughn Following up on last month’s column, which saw Hake’s Americana & Collectibles on track to set multiple records for the company with Auction #223, the results surpassed expectations. The auction, which closed from Tuesday – Thursday, March 13-15, 2018, totaled $2,357,183. This marked the first auction to surpass $2 […]
